
Quality Power shares jump 4% on launch of Global Coil Factory in Sangli
Shares of Quality Power Electrical Equipments surged 4% after the company announced the launch of its state-of-the-art Global Coil Factory in Kupwad MIDC, Sangli, Maharashtra. This marks a key milestone in the company's growth strategy, as discussed in its recent board meeting and quarterly earnings update.
The facility is positioned to become one of the world's largest for air-core and oil-filled reactor manufacturing, catering to growing global demand for HVDC, STATCOM, and FACTS system components. Equipped with 44 high-end winding lines and a world-class high-voltage testing lab, the plant underlines Quality Power's focus on innovation and quality.
Aligned with sustainability goals, the factory is being built to meet IGBC Platinum certification standards—making it one of the greenest manufacturing sites globally.
Execution of the project is in collaboration with top industry names including Arwade Infrastructure, Kirby Building Systems, and Electromech. In line with its reverse integration plans, the company has already placed orders for advanced cable manufacturing machinery.
Shares of Quality Power opened at ₹617.05 and touched an intraday high of ₹638.70, also marking a new 52-week high. The stock saw a low of ₹610.00 during the session. Its 52-week range now stands between ₹267.80 and ₹638.70.

Titagarh Rail secures Rs 430.53 crore order for Pune Metro
By Aman Shukla Published on June 28, 2025, 15:22 IST Titagarh Rail Systems Limited, along with its associate company Titagarh Firema S.p.A, has received a Letter of Approval from Maharashtra Metro Rail Corporation Limited for the supply of 12 additional trainsets for the Pune Metro Rail Project. The order is a variation under Clause A.6 of the original contract (P1/RS-01/2018), which covers the design, manufacture, supply, testing, commissioning of electrical multiple units (EMUs), and personnel training. This latest addition brings the total order value for this variation to approximately ₹430.53 crore. This development builds on the earlier contract awarded in August 2019 and reflects Maha-Metro's continued trust in the Titagarh group for delivering high-quality rolling stock solutions. The contract is to be fulfilled within a 30-month timeframe. The order is entirely domestic and aligns with the broader infrastructure push for metro rail networks across Indian cities. Rainbow Children's Medicare acquires majority stake in Prashanthi Hospital
By Aman Shukla Published on June 28, 2025, 14:30 IST Rainbow Children's Medicare Limited (RCML) has announced the acquisition of a majority stake in Prashanthi Medicare Private Limited, a reputed 100-bed NABH-accredited hospital in Warangal, Telangana. The acquisition marks a strategic expansion into tier-II cities and enhances RCML's presence in southern India. Established in 2015 by Dr. Prasanthi Macha, Prashanthi Hospital is recognized for excellence in obstetrics, gynecology, neonatology, pediatrics, and minimally invasive surgery. The hospital has built a strong regional reputation and continues to serve as a trusted destination for maternal and child healthcare in Warangal, Telangana's second-largest district. With this acquisition, RCML's total bed capacity increases to 2,035 across 20 hospitals in seven cities. The transaction, valued at approximately ₹32.60 crore (subject to working capital adjustments), is based on 9x estimated FY25 adjusted EBITDA and will be funded through internal accruals and cash reserves. RCML will acquire a 76% equity stake and 100% of the Non-convertible Redeemable Preference Shares (NCRPS), while Dr. Macha and associates will retain a 24% minority stake. Post-acquisition, the facility will operate under a dual brand: Rainbow Children's Hospital for pediatric services and Prashanthi with BirthRight for women's health services. The integration will support RCML's hub-and-spoke model, ensuring efficient referrals and clinical alignment with its Hyderabad tertiary care hub. Sarda Energy receives consent to operate Coal Gasifier Plant in Raipur
Sarda Energy & Minerals Limited has recently informed exchanges that the company received approval from the Chhattisgarh Environment Conservation Board (CECB), Raipur, to operate its Coal Gasifier Plant. The consent has been granted under the provisions of the Water (Prevention and Control of Pollution) Act, 1974 and the Air (Prevention and Control of Pollution) Act, 1981. According to the disclosure, the consent covers the operation of a Coal Gasifier Plant with a capacity of 3,606.15 Nm³/hr. The unit is intended for use at the company's Pellet Plant located in Raipur, Chhattisgarh. This regulatory approval allows Sarda Energy & Minerals to proceed with operations at the specified capacity in accordance with environmental compliance requirements. In the meantime, Sarda Energy & Minerals shares closed at ₹450.20 on Friday. The stock opened at ₹448.50 and touched a high of ₹452.00 during the day, while the low stood at ₹444.85.
